Fethiye Jeep Safari: Saklıkent Gorge and Gizlikent WaterfallA 6-hour jeep safari from Fethiye explores Saklıkent Gorge and Gizlikent Waterfall in a 4-wheel-drive Land Rover with a live English-speaking guide. The tour includes hotel pickup, lunch, entrance fees, a natural mud bath, and time to walk the wooden walkways inside the 18-kilometer gorge. Oludeniz boat trip with swimming: Blue Cave, Butterfly ValleyA seven-hour boat trip departing from Oludeniz harbor visits the Blue Cave, Butterfly Valley, Soguksu Bay and Camel Beach, with four swimming stops, lunch and an English-speaking crew. The boat leaves early and returns by late afternoon; lunch is served at Camel Beach, where real camels stand on the shore and riders can mount them if they choose.
